Question
कथं मारात्मके त्वयि विश्वासः ?

Answer

Being violent by nature, how can I trust you ?
Explanation: This line has been taken from the story 'कङ्कणस्य तु लोभेन' of Hitopesh composed by Vishnu Sharma. In this line, addressing the old tiger, the traveller says, "Being violent by nature, how can I trust you?" The theme of this story is that how an old tiger shrewdly tries to trap its prey. The tiger has become old and weak so it can not hunt animals as it did in its youth. So it tries to trap traveller by offering golden bracelet it has. He knows that human being is greedy by nature and soon the traveller will..get trapped. The traveller becomes ready to take risk. He asks the tiger where the golden bracelet is. The tiger shows him the bracelet by spreading its hand. At that time the traveller says, "Being violent by nature, how can I trust you ?"
   Thus this statement indicates that an animal can not give up its violent nature. Even though, the travelled takes risk due to greed and is killed by the tiger.
